"Fast and fun card game on molecules from organic chemistry - great for revision and students learning to recognise and naming molecules
There is only one symbol that two cards have in common and it’s different for every card pair - can students find it and name it?
Cards are distributed between players. One card is placed in the middle. Players hold their cards as a pile with the top card showing symbols. The player who can first find the matching symbol between his top card and the card in the middle calls out that symbol and places his top card in the middle. Now the matching symbol of that card with the players’ top cards has to be found. The player who manages to get rid of all his cards first is the winner.
Print out several copies, laminate, chop up, play!
42 cards with 7 symbols each
play in groups of 3-5

Card game on 40 acids and alkalis and their characteristics (pH, mass, strength of acid/base, density, boiling point, melting point, hazards etc)
Rules: Players compare different categories. The top value always trumps the other cards and the player with the top value obtains the other cards. The player with the most cards is the winner.
A great starter or plenary or revision activity.
Print out several copies, laminate, chop up, play!
